Decoding the FR4 TG 180 Datasheet Material Properties
The FR4 TG 180 Datasheet outlines a range of crucial characteristics that define its suitability for various applications. “TG” stands for “glass transition temperature,” which is a critical parameter. A TG of 180°C signifies that the material maintains its rigidity and structural integrity up to this temperature. This high TG value makes FR4 TG 180 a good choice for applications where PCBs are exposed to elevated temperatures.
FR4 TG 180 finds extensive use in several applications because of its high thermal resistance. Here are some of the key properties commonly found in an FR4 TG 180 Datasheet:
- Glass Transition Temperature (Tg): Typically 180°C, indicating the temperature at which the material transitions from a rigid to a more rubbery state.
- Decomposition Temperature (Td): The temperature at which the material begins to decompose.
- Dielectric Constant (Dk): A measure of the material’s ability to store electrical energy.
- Dissipation Factor (Df): A measure of the energy lost as heat in the material.
- Coefficient of Thermal Expansion (CTE): A measure of how much the material expands or contracts with changes in temperature.
Furthermore, FR4 TG 180 Datasheets often include information about mechanical properties, such as tensile strength, flexural strength, and impact resistance. These properties are vital for assessing the material’s ability to withstand physical stresses during manufacturing and operation.
